Coordination between the Baja California and Chiapas Prosecutors’ Offices results in the capture of “El Boxer” for qualified homicide and attempted homicide

In a joint operation between the Attorney General’s Office of the State of Baja California and the Attorney General’s Office of the State of Chiapas, Juan Miguel “N”, alias “el Boxer”, was arrested and transferred from Tuxtla Gutiérrez, Chiapas, to Tijuana, Baja California.

Juan Miguel “N” is wanted by the judicial authority due to his alleged participation in two criminal cases for aggravated homicide and attempted aggravated homicide.

The arrest was possible thanks to the coordinated effort between federal, state and municipal authorities, in compliance with collaboration agreements for the arrest of individuals with outstanding judicial warrants.

The events that led to his capture include an incident that occurred on November 2, 2010, at approximately 8:00 p.m., in the San Luis neighborhood, where Juan Miguel “N”, along with other individuals, shot José Luis García, known as “el Chepe”, who died on the spot. In addition, he is accused of shooting another individual, who managed to escape unharmed.

Additionally, he faces charges of qualified homicide in the degree of co-authorship and attempted homicide in the Second Criminal Court, related to an incident in the Ejido Lázaro Cárdenas, where several people were injured and two lost their lives.

Juan Miguel “el Boxer” is linked to a criminal group, which increases the seriousness of the charges against him.

Due to the dangerousness of the detainee, a special operation was implemented during his transfer to the El Hongo Social Rehabilitation Center, in Tecate, under strict security measures, with the participation of the State Investigation Agency of the Tijuana Zone.
